35 years ago, the term Dynamic Impact Beds for conveyor load zones did not exist. Richard Sharp coined the phrase to make clear the difference from static impact beds, then dominating the marketplace. This invention dramatically improved heavy duty load zone, conveyor belt protection by dissipating kinetic energy.
